Andy and Margaret Becker are married baby boomers enjoying their retirement when Margaret discovers a book that refuels her longtime dream of traveling to Provence. Now all she has to do is convince a reluctant Andy to embark on a journey with her that will forever change their lives and their marriage.

Despite the fact that Andy has discussed traveling to Provence for decades, he soon finds himself trapped in Margarets web of adventure. After he agrees to rent a house in Provence where he and Margaret can walk to the market, have lunch in a caf, and enjoy baguettes accompanied by unpasteurized cheese and lavender honey, Andy must adjust to sleeping in a tiny bed, changing lanes in traffic circles, and eating more bad carbohydrates than he ever has in his life. But Andy makes the best of his adventure, fully embedding himself in the French culture and even falling in love with the scraggly dog that lives on the property surrounding their wee house.

After a series of humorous events, Andy is unknowingly initiated into a freer way of life as he experiences the people, the unhurried atmosphere of French eating and drinking, and the fascinating history of Provence.
